Medical Overview

Allopurinol is listed as Other containing Allopurinol. A medicine used according to its active ingredient, dosage form, and the patient’s condition.

Allopurinol — gout’s foundational urate-lowerer: shuts the xanthine-oxidase factory, dissolving deposits toward a numeric target (<6mg/dl; <5 with tophi). The twin famous rules: start low/titrate with colchicine cover (initiation mobilizes crystals and flares), and never START during an acute attack — but never STOP if already on. Early rash = same-day stop (SJS/DRESS, HLA-B*5801); azathioprine interaction is potentially lethal.

Uses / Indications

  • Chronic gout
  • hyperuricemia
  • Used for indications selected by a clinician or pharmacist based on diagnosis and the official leaflet.

Side Effects

  • Rash (potentially serious)
  • hepatic impairment
  • gastrointestinal disturbance
  • Side effects vary by active ingredient, dose, and patient factors.

Warnings

  • Do not initiate during acute gout attack
  • HLA-B*5801 screening in Asian patients
  • Do not start, stop, or change dose without medical advice, especially during pregnancy or chronic disease.
